Allon Raiz speaks and lectures to audiences and business schools across the globe. His organisation, Raizcorp, has spent the past two decades incubating over 13 000 entrepreneurial businesses. His exposure to thousands of entrepreneurial journeys, as well as his own, has resulted in an unmatched depth of experience in the field of entrepreneurship. Raizor’s Edge is devoted to entrepreneurs at various stages of their journeys who may use these conversations as a catalyst to solving a problem, as an affirmation of a strategy or for more insight and additional knowledge. The power of "I will" 28.03.2024

In this episode, Allon Raiz discusses the importance of the third step in his shower routine: "I will". This is when you lock in your targets, almost commanding yourself to move forward and achieve them, and tap into your "why" - a powerful combination that creates momentum and serves as a reminder of your determination. The power of “I can” 27.02.2024

In this episode, Allon Raiz describes the pivotal second step in his motivational shower routine: I can. This is where you remind yourself that you have the ability to achieve what you’ve set out to do and create a mental plan on how to do it – it helps you build up a level of confidence and that’s what creates the forward movement in your mind. Our journey towards becoming unimportant 25.08.2023

Whether you’re the CEO or a staff member, tightly holding on to knowledge and relationships effectively means career stagnation and eventually becoming a constraint in the business. In this episode, Allon Raiz discusses how you should be building a culture in which you encourage your management to delegate projects, processes and knowledge to other team members. Lack of rhythmic, well-designed meetings 21.07.2023

Without rhythmic, well-designed meetings, there is no order and no predictability and a very high probability of misalignment across the organisation. In this episode of 20 Lessons Over 20 Years, Allon Raiz discusses why meetings – done correctly – are actually one of the most important tools entrepreneurs have to drive strategy and communication. What would you do with $100 million? 21.02.2023

An investor is always going to probe the amount of money you’re asking them to invest. They want to make sure you’ve correctly gauged what you need to scale your business and that you’re not going to come back to them in six months or a year to ask for more. What keeps you up at night? 31.01.2023

Investors want to make sure you are aware of all the risks that may affect your business – which you may not have mentioned during your actual pitch. They need to know you’ve considered all possible risks and they especially want to know which are the ones that give you sleepless nights. When answering this question, you need to be honest. Defensive moats and strategies 24.01.2023

Dealing with competition is an inevitable part of business. It’s simply a fact that when your business begins to thrive, new competitors will emerge and they will want a piece of the market pie. You need to show your potential investors during your pitch that you have strategies in place to build defensive “moats” to keep the competition at bay. Indirect competitors 10.01.2023

When you’re delivering an investor pitch, it’s vital to show your potential investors that you are aware of who your indirect competitors are. These are businesses who may entice your target audience to spend their hard-earned money elsewhere, even if it’s on a different product or service. Letters of intent 03.01.2023

It’s important for you to be able to show potential investors that parties who are doing business with you have given you some form of commitment. Investors always try to mitigate their risk so if you can produce letters of intent during your pitch, it will increase your chances of getting funding.
